Output 5dbf36c0993fc938129fa437f74803c587f5538827cd4e9563ef1aef57a5e310:0

value
23397700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da629df3fa60049e4438fdb91fd1d017aeb32012 OP_EQUAL
address
3MbjNPi88zKrAd9XnwF9wUUaLK6MZnyMBr
transaction
5dbf36c0993fc938129fa437f74803c587f5538827cd4e9563ef1aef57a5e310
spent
true